Transaction 3722375e24dc39c412126ee9d606b931c9962314050418ff914f7d712617a453
1 Input
1 Output
-
3722375e24dc39c412126ee9d606b931c9962314050418ff914f7d712617a453:0
- value
- 13853024
- script pubkey
- OP_0 OP_PUSHBYTES_20 89b7a05b8722a1abfbecd1a902537200faa2f616
- address
- bc1q3xm6qku8y2s6h7lv6x5sy5mjqra29ask0vccgz